OLD DOMINION PROFESSOR TESTIFIES BEFORE HOUSE COMMITTEE

Bryan Porter, assistant professor of psychology at Old Dominion University, testified Thursday before a Virginia House transportation subcommittee about his research on drivers' red-light-running behavior.

Porter also discussed the behavioral effectiveness of photo-red technology -- automatic cameras that take pictures of red-light-running vehicles.

The House Transportation Committee is considering bills expanding the use of photo enforcement for red-light running to localities not covered under current law. Porter was invited by those interested in such legislation since his research generally supports the technology's effectiveness.
